Purpose and Job Summary

ORIX USA is seeking a Senior Tax Accountant to join the ORIX USA Tax team. This position will provide support for the corporate tax department, specifically related to federal and state tax compliance projects and tax planning/special projects.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Perform tax compliance projects related to federal/state tax return preparation for both corporations and partnerships

  • Participate in state estimate, extension, and tax provision processes

  • Management and preparation of responses to IRS and state exam information requests and other correspondence

  • Participate in various tax special projects (including, but not limited to transfer pricing, tax credits, mergers and acquisitions, international tax issues

  • Work professionally and harmoniously with team and coworkers

  • Other projects and duties as assigned

Contacts

This position has frequent contact with all levels of employees and management. In addition, this role may interact with outside business partners, vendors, consultants, and other office visitors.

Education, Skills & Experience

Required

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ting from an accredited four-year university

  • 2 – 3 years of experience with a Big Four public Accounting firm

  • Experience in preparation of federal income tax returns

  • Experience handling complex and diverse tax issues

  • High proficiency in Microsoft Outlook, Word, and Excel

  • Superior academic record with demonstrated quantitative, analytical, and mathematical skills

  • Demonstrated ability to work independently and as part of a high-performance team; flexibility and ability to work under pressure

  • Ability to adjust priorities in a rapidly changing environment

  • Excellent organizational, commun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ills

  • Ability to plan, organize, and prioritize assignments, and to meet critical and established deadlines

  • Ability to manage multiple assignments simultaneously

Preferred

  • Graduate degree

  • Experience in preparation of state tax returns
